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ials for barn roof replacement typ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of material chosen, such as metal or asphalt shingles. For a standard barn, this can translate to a total material cost of approximately $1,000 to $4,000. Variations depend on the quality and style of materials selected.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for barn roof replacement gener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our per worker. For an average-sized barn, total labor charges might range from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the project's complexity and duration. These costs are influenced by local rates and contractor expertise.
Project Size & Scope - The overall cost is affected by the size and complexity of the barn roof, with smaller projects around $2,000 and larger, more complex replacements reaching $10,000 or more. Factors such as roof pitch, accessibility, and existing damage can influence the final price. Contact local pros for detailed estimates based on specific barn dimensions.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include removal of old roofing, permits, or repairs to underlying structures, which can add $500 to $2,000 or more. These costs vary based on the condition of the existing roof and local regulations. It is advisable to get comprehensive quotes from service providers for accurate budgeting.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should barn roofs be replaced? The lifespan of a barn roof varies based on materials and maintenance, but replacement is typically considered every 20-30 years or when significant damage occurs.
What signs indicate a barn roof needs replacement? Visible damage such as missing shingles, leaks, sagging areas, or extensive rust can suggest the roof requires replacement.
Are there different roofing options for barns? Yes, options include metal, asphalt shingles, wood shingles, and rubber roofing, each with its own benefits and suitability for different barn structures.
How long does a barn roof replacement usually take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the barn, but most replacements can be completed within a few days by local service providers.
